How a Late-Night Doorbell Led to an Unexpected Lesson in Awareness

As I drew closer, I noticed a faint, unfamiliar sound beneath the hum of the hallway light. It wasn’t another

ring of the bell—it was a subtle clicking noise coming from the lock. In that moment, my heart raced, and my thoughts scattered.

I stood frozen, unsure whether to move, speak, or retreat. Fear has a way of making time stretch, and those few seconds felt endless.

I reminded myself to breathe and stay calm. Panicking wouldn’t help. I stepped back quietly, my mind searching for a safe and sensible response that wouldn’t put me in danger.

That was when clarity broke through the fear. Instead of confronting the situation directly, I reached for my phone and turned on every

light in the apartment. I switched on the television, raising the volume just enough to suggest that others might be inside with me.

Then I spoke out loud, firmly and confidently,

as if someone else were in the next room. I mentioned calling for help and casually referenced neighbors nearby. The goal wasn’t to

threaten, but to signal awareness and presence. Almost immediately, the noise at the door stopped. The hallway fell silent again,

this time in a way that felt relieving rather than tense.

After a few minutes, I contacted building security and calmly explained what had happened. They arrived quickly and checked the area,

reassuring me that I had done the right thing by staying inside and making my home seem occupied. Later, once everything was settled, I sat on my couch reflecting on how quickly fear can turn

into strength when you pause and think clearly. That night taught me that being alone doesn’t mean being powerless. Awareness, preparation,

and calm decision-making can make all the difference. While the experience was unsettling, it left me feeling more confident, reminding me that sometimes

the brightest ideas come in the moments when we choose courage over panic.
